Key Concepts Covered
➡️ Nutrient cycle pathways – Understanding how minerals and nutrients move through ecosystems
➡️ Decomposition – The breakdown of organic matter by decomposers and its role in nutrient recycling
➡️ Nitrogen fixation – Conversion of atmospheric nitrogen into forms usable by plants
➡️ Environmental factors affecting nutrient cycling – Exploring how moisture, temperature, and other conditions influence decomposition rates
➡️ Role of decomposers and bacteria – Recognizing their essential functions in maintaining ecosystem health
